If you’re looking for a yogurt that could help with some acid reflux or heartburn symptoms, look no further than greek yogurt. The following foods may help you ease or avoid symptoms. Yogurt is a dairy product that often causes abdominal pain, bloating, diarrhea, and heartburn in those with a sensitivity or severe allergy to dairy. Acid reflux is a common condition, but lifestyle changes, including eating more of certain foods like oatmeal, bananas and green vegetables, can help cool the burn. Most greek yogurts have been created by removing whey. Yogurt may trigger or aggravate heartburn, in part, because some brands are high in total fat and contain saturated fat, which can worsen gerd.
